How to Record Your Screen with Internal Audio in Windows 10: A Comprehensive Guide

Recording your screen with internal audio in Windows 10 can be a useful feature for various purposes, such as creating tutorials, presentations, or even recording gameplay. However, many users struggle to find a reliable method to achieve this. In this article, we will explore the different ways to record your screen with internal audio in Windows 10, including built-in tools and third-party software.

Using Built-in Tools: Game Bar and OBS Studio

Windows 10 offers a built-in tool called Game Bar that allows you to record your screen with internal audio. While it’s primarily designed for recording gameplay, you can use it to record any screen activity.

Recording with Game Bar

To record your screen with Game Bar, follow these steps:

  1. Press the Windows key + G to open the Game Bar.
  2. Click on the microphone icon to enable or disable the audio recording.
  3. Click on the record button (or press the Windows key + Alt + R) to start recording.
  4. To stop recording, click on the stop button (or press the Windows key + Alt + R again).

The recorded video will be saved in the “Captures” folder, which can be accessed by pressing the Windows key + E and navigating to the “Videos” folder.

What are the system requirements for recording screen with internal audio in Windows 10?

To record your screen with internal audio in Windows 10, your system should meet certain requirements. First, ensure that your computer is running Windows 10 version 1903 or later. Additionally, your system should have a compatible sound card that supports stereo mix or a similar feature. You can check your sound card compatibility by navigating to the Sound settings in your Control Panel. If your sound card supports stereo mix, you should see it listed as an option under the Recording tab.

It’s also essential to have a reliable screen recording software that supports internal audio capture. Some popular options include OBS Studio, XSplit, and Bandicam. Make sure to check the system requirements for the software you choose to ensure it’s compatible with your Windows 10 version. If your system meets these requirements, you’re ready to start recording your screen with internal audio.

How do I enable stereo mix in Windows 10 to record internal audio?

To enable stereo mix in Windows 10, navigate to the Sound settings in your Control Panel. You can do this by typing “Sound” in the Windows search bar and selecting the Sound settings option. In the Sound window, click on the Recording tab and look for the Stereo Mix option. If you don’t see it listed, right-click on the empty space and select “Show Disabled Devices.” This should make the Stereo Mix option appear.

Once you’ve located the Stereo Mix option, right-click on it and select “Enable.” This will allow you to capture internal audio when recording your screen. Make sure to set Stereo Mix as the default recording device by right-clicking on it and selecting “Set as Default Device.” This will ensure that your screen recording software captures the internal audio correctly.
